Statesmen Drop Non-Conference Series to Hurricanes

Statesmen Drop Non-Conference Series to Hurricanes

SOUTH PRINCE GEORGE, VA – The Richard Bland College Baseball team traveled to Louisburg College Friday afternoon for a non-conference doubleheader, and hosted the Hurricanes for game three of the series, Saturday afternoon. After completion of the games, the Statesmen moved to 12-13 overall, 5-9 in conference play after dropping the games 0-10, 6-12, and 14-29.

 

In game one, Richard Bland had trouble keeping up with Louisburg in a 0-10 loss Friday afternoon. A home run put the Hurricanes on the board in the bottom of the third. Louisburg scored five runs on four hits in the bottom of the sixth inning. Sam Gupta, the number eight hitter, led the Statesmen with two hits in two at bats. Nate Riggs took the loss for Richard Bland. The righty went five innings, surrendering five runs on five hits, striking out four, and walking three. Michael Keyes came in, in relief, and surrendered five runs on four hits, striking out none, and walking three.

 

In game two, Macho Santiago collected three hits in four at bats, but Richard Bland lost to the Hurricanes 6-12 in the nightcap Friday. Santiago singled in the first, third, and fifth innings. Richard Bland opened the scoring in the first after Jordan Ramsey homered to center field, scoring two runs. Louisburg took the lead in the bottom of the second inning. Ramsey provided pop in the middle of the lineup, leading Richard Bland with two runs batted in. The Statesmen turned one double play on in the game on defense. Jack Rucker took the loss for Richard Bland. The left-handed pitcher went two and one-third innings, surrendering eight runs on eight hits, striking out one and walking one.

 

In game three, Jordan Ramsey drove in four on one hit, but the Statesmen fell 14-29 at home. Richard Bland collected 12 hits in the game. Louisburg opened the scoring in the top of the second thanks to two singles. The Hurricanes added seven runs on six hits in the top of the third inning to extend the lead, 0-11. Richard Bland cut the deficit to three in the bottom of the fourth, which included a solo home run to right field by Macho Santiago. The Statesmen scored nine runs on five hits in the bottom of the fifth inning. Keegan Mahoney hit a grand slam to right field, Carson Herod drew a walk, scoring one run, and Ramsey hit a grand slam to left field. Louisburg scored 13 runs on nine hits in the top of the sixth inning. Connor Powell, Herod, Santiago, and Sam Gupta each collected two hits for the Statesmen. Mahoney and Ramsey drove in four runs each for the Statesmen. Jackson Hulcher took the loss for Richard Bland. The starting pitcher went two and one-third innings, allowing 10 runs on nine hits, striking out one and walking two.
